About Your New Job

As a Senior Commercial Property Manager, you will play a pivotal role in driving the growth and strategic direction of our commercial property business. You will be a key member of the management team, responsible for:

  • Build and nurture strong relationships with key clients and stakeholders.
  • Manage budget planning and business strategy development.
  • Supervising, expanding, and optimizing departmental functions.
  • Take the lead on various commercial properties across different asset categories with key clients.
  • Manage all facets of property management including financial planning, lettings, rent collection and tenant applications.
  • Working closely with numerous internal team including but not limited to legal, financial, and technical experts.
  • Advise and develop existing client relationships to maximize cross-selling opportunities.
  • Represent the company in ongoing business development activities.
  • Participate in pre-due diligence processes in accordance with company policies.
  • Suggesting effective software/systems for enhanced execution.
  • Leading the implementation of environmental, social, and governance (ESG) initiatives and requirements

What Skills You Need

The ideal candidate will have:

  • 5 or more years experience in a similar role within a commercial real estate firm.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team, showing initiative and integrity.
  • A degree-level qualification.
  • SCSI/RICS qualification and PSRA license (or eligibility to obtain)
  • A clean driving license.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ills.
  • A dynamic approach to identifying new business opportunities.
  • Strong client focus and att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, and Word.
  • Effective communication and integration at all organizational levels.
  • Ability to prioritize work and multi-task.
  • Willingness to travel internationally as needed.
